What are the 10 guiding principles of recovery? - CORRECT ANSWER - 1.Person driven
2many pathways
3holistic
4peer support,
5relational
6culture
7address trauma,
8strengths/responsibility,
9 respect,
10Hope.

What is the working definition of Recovery from mental disorders, and/or substance use
disorders? - CORRECT ANSWER - A process of changed through which in individuals
improve their health and wellness, live a self directed life and strive to reach their full potential.

Through the Recovery Support Strategic Initiative, SAMHSA's has delineated what FOUR major
dimensions that support a life in recovery? - CORRECT ANSWER - 1.Health
2. Home
3.Purpose
4. Community
What is ambivalence? - CORRECT ANSWER - The state of having mixed feelings or
contradictory ideas about something.
The uncertainty and hesitation about fully committing to sobriety .
What does ADA stand for and what year was it passed? - CORRECT ANSWER -
Americans with Disabilities Act of 1990
What is motivational interviewing? - CORRECT ANSWER - a client-centered, directive
method for enhancing intrinsic motivation to change by exploring and resolving ambivalence
What is cognitive behavioral therapy CBT? - CORRECT ANSWER - Cognitive
Behavioral Therapy is a psycho-social intervention that aims to reduce symptoms of various
mental health conditions, primarily depression and anxiety disorders. Cognitive behavioral
therapy is one of the most effective means of treatment for substance abuse and co-occurring
mental health disorders.
What is the addictive process? - CORRECT ANSWER - Introductory Phase
Maintenance phase
Disenchantment phase
, Disaster phase
What is dialectic behavioral therapy DBT? - CORRECT ANSWER - Dialectical behavior
therapy is an evidence-based psychotherapy that began with efforts to treat personality disorders
and interpersonal conflicts. Evidence suggests that DBT can be useful in treating mood disorders
and suicidal ideation, as well as for changing behavioral patterns such as self-harm and substance
use.
